LOOKUP INFORMATION FOR FIELD IS INCOMPLETE ДЕЛФИ

При выполнении запросов к базам данных в Delphi иногда может возникать ошибка «lookup information for field is incomplete», которая указывает на то, что информация в поле таблицы не полна. Это может произойти, если поле ссылающейся таблицы содержит информацию, которой нет в связанной таблице. Например, если родительская таблица имеет поле "Категория", которое ссылается на поле "ID" в дочерней таблице, но в дочерней таблице отсутствует соответствующий идентификатор "ID", то возникает ошибка.Чтобы решить эту проблему, необходимо проверить данные в обеих таблицах и добавить информацию, если она отсутствует. Дополнительно, можно убедиться, что вы используете правильный тип данных для поля, а также проверить наличие соответствующих индексов в таблицах.Пример кода на Delphi:with Query1 dobegin SQL.Clear; SQL.Add('SELECT * FROM Customers'); SQL.Add('LEFT OUTER JOIN Orders ON'); SQL.Add('Customers.CustomerID = Orders.CustomerID'); Open;end;Этот пример кода демонстрирует использование оператора слияния соединения для объединения двух таблиц Customers и Orders в одной команде SELECT. Если у нас есть пропущенные данные в одной из таблиц, мы можем получить ошибку "lookup information for field is incomplete". Чтобы обойти эту проблему, мы можем использовать внешнее соединение, которое позволяет извлекать данные из обеих таблиц, даже если в них есть пропущенные данные.Надеюсь, эта информация поможет вам решить проблему с ошибкой "lookup information for field is incomplete" в Delphi.

C++ : Error: Field has an incomplete type

Django : RetrieveAPIView without lookup field?

The Application Has Failed to Start Because Its Side by Side Configuration Is Incorrect [Tutorial]

Delphi Simple CRUD with ActionList, DBLookupComboBox and Lookup Field Features

SQL : How to deselect values in multivalue lookup field using a query

C++ : \

Реклама
Новое
Реклама